Ottis W. “Hump” Lewis, Jr., 71, of Ocilla, Georgia, died Sunday, November 30, 2003, at Tift Regional Medical Center.
Funeral services will be held 2 P.M. Wednesday, December 3, 2003 at the Paulk Funeral Home Chapel in Fitzgerald, with Rev. Kelly Brown and Rev. James Hubbard officiating. Interment will follow in Evergreen Cemetery. The family will receive friends from 7 to 9 P.M. Tuesday, at the funeral home.
Mr. Lewis was born June 1, 1932 in Irwin County, Georgia to the late Ottis Willis, Sr. & Mary Kelly Lewis and was also preceded in death by his wife, Sandra Tucci Lewis. He was a retired farmer and former owner/operator of Lewis Oil Company and Texaco Service Station. Mr. Lewis was a member of the Fitzgerald 1948 State Championship Football Team and played football for two years at the University Of Georgia. He was a loving father and husband and a member of the First Baptist Church in Fitzgerald.
Survivors include: Daughter: Michele Walker, Ocilla; Son: O.W. “Chad” Lewis, III, Ocilla; Sister: Madie Denton, Osierfield; Aunt: Nell Grace Burden, Fitzgerald
